Factors Affecting Installation Cost
Cedar roof installation in York County, ME, involves selecting appropriate materials, understanding project scope, and navigating local permitting requirements. This overview provides a neutral outline of typical considerations and project components for cedar roofing projects in the area.
- Materials: Premium Western Red Cedar or Eastern White Cedar are common choices, offering durability and aesthetic appeal suitable for the New England climate.
- Size and Scope: Projects can range from small residential roofs to larger multi-story structures, with scope influencing overall project complexity.
- Labor Complexity: Installing cedar roofing requires precise craftsmanship, especially for complex roof designs or steep slopes, impacting labor time and skill requirements.
- Permitting: Local building permits are typically necessary for roof replacements or new installations, with requirements varying by municipality within York County.
- Extras: Additional considerations may include underlayment options, ventilation systems, and protective finishes to enhance longevity and performance.
